Action Steps
  1. Collect and preprocess gene expression data from cancer patients using tools like Python and Pandas
  2. Train a machine learning model using techniques like supervised learning and neural networks to predict metastasis
  3. Integrate the model with clinical data and validate its performance using metrics like accuracy and sensitivity
  4. Continuously monitor and update the model to ensure clinical utility and adapt to new data
  5. Collaborate with clinicians to interpret results and develop personalized treatment plans
